上一篇主題 :: 下一篇主題 |
發表人 |
內容 |
ckp6250
註冊時間: 2004-07-30 文章: 1644
第 1 樓
|
發表於: 星期日 二月 26, 2012 8:43 pm 文章主題: Record is out of range |
|
|
這是我的一個 dbc (如附檔)
當要打開 Stored Procedures 時
就會出現 Record is out of range
修了半天,也修不好,
請先進們幫忙試著修看看 |
|
回頂端 |
|
|
sean27
註冊時間: 2008-08-17 文章: 49
第 2 樓
|
發表於: 星期日 二月 26, 2012 10:26 pm 文章主題: |
|
|
打開 Stored Procedures --> ok 呀 沒錯誤發生!
--------------------------------------------------------
*身份證及統一編號檢查程式
Function Check_id
Parameters vId,ShowMessage
If Parameters()<2
ShowMessage="證號"
Endif
vId=Strtran(vId,' ','')
ErrMsg=""
Do Case
Case Len(vId)=10
ErrMsg=CheckPersonID(vId)
Case Len(vId)=8
ErrMsg=CheckCustomerID(vId)
Otherwise
ErrMsg="證號長度不符"
Endcase
If ! Empty(ErrMsg)
=Messagebox(ShowMessage+'【'+vId+"】"+ErrMsg+"。",16,"統一編號檢查作業",3000)
Endif
Return .T.
*!* ***************************************
*!* *** 台灣人員身分證/外僑/外勞ID檢查 ***
*!* *************************************** _________________ foxpro & php 初學者 |
|
回頂端 |
|
|
ckp6250
註冊時間: 2004-07-30 文章: 1644
第 3 樓
|
發表於: 星期日 二月 26, 2012 10:51 pm 文章主題: |
|
|
感謝幫忙
在我的電腦上,是這樣的
不知何故? |
|
回頂端 |
|
|
sean27
註冊時間: 2008-08-17 文章: 49
第 4 樓
|
發表於: 星期一 二月 27, 2012 9:47 am 文章主題: |
|
|
我是從 vfp8 開啟的 modify database company --> edit stored procedure 沒問題 _________________ foxpro & php 初學者 |
|
回頂端 |
|
|
marvin
註冊時間: 2004-06-01 文章: 321
第 5 樓
|
發表於: 星期一 二月 27, 2012 1:40 pm 文章主題: |
|
|
下載後打開, 沒問題呢 |
|
回頂端 |
|
|
ckp6250
註冊時間: 2004-07-30 文章: 1644
第 6 樓
|
發表於: 星期一 二月 27, 2012 4:12 pm 文章主題: |
|
|
sean27 寫到: | 我是從 vfp8 開啟的 modify database company --> edit stored procedure 沒問題 |
感謝幫忙
再試了一下,用您的方法,的確可以成功,但若由 Project Manager 中去開啟 stored procedure(如附圖),就會出現錯誤。
能否麻煩您用我的方法試一下嗎? |
|
回頂端 |
|
|
garfield Site Admin
註冊時間: 2003-01-30 文章: 2157
第 7 樓
|
發表於: 星期三 二月 29, 2012 11:17 am 文章主題: |
|
|
我用Project Manager 去開啟都沒事,
會不會是因為你是在 Wine 下使用才有這種狀況?
在Wine 之下
use company.dbc excl
pack
PACK memo
reindex
看看行不行 _________________ 利用>>搜尋<<的功能會比問的還要快得到答案. |
|
回頂端 |
|
|
ckp6250
註冊時間: 2004-07-30 文章: 1644
第 8 樓
|
發表於: 星期三 二月 29, 2012 7:47 pm 文章主題: |
|
|
感謝garfield
您的方法,試過了,也是無效。
我也有懷疑是 wine 的問題,但在windwos 7 和 windows xp 下,也都有同樣問題。
莫非是我的 VFP 有問題?
這下變成無頭公案啦,各位試都OK , 我怎麼試都有問題。
好在sean27的方法尚能用,就得過且過啦。 |
|
回頂端 |
|
|
marvin
註冊時間: 2004-06-01 文章: 321
第 9 樓
|
發表於: 星期四 三月 01, 2012 1:41 pm 文章主題: |
|
|
會不會是 有中文所以有問題 ? |
|
回頂端 |
|
|
ckp6250
註冊時間: 2004-07-30 文章: 1644
第 10 樓
|
發表於: 星期四 三月 01, 2012 3:29 pm 文章主題: |
|
|
marvin 寫到: | 會不會是 有中文所以有問題 ? |
不是中文問題,我其它的 dbc , 和這個 dbc 中的 Stored Procedure 內容一模一樣,但就是沒問題。 |
|
回頂端 |
|
|
chilin
註冊時間: 2003-10-01 文章: 79 來自: Taipei,Taiwan
第 11 樓
|
發表於: 星期五 三月 09, 2012 11:54 pm 文章主題: |
|
|
wine+vfp9 剛好有相同環境,測了一下,可以正常開啟。 _________________ 一個喜愛Latte的男人 |
|
回頂端 |
|
|
raster
註冊時間: 2010-02-03 文章: 15
第 12 樓
|
發表於: 星期四 五月 03, 2012 12:10 pm 文章主題: |
|
|
把全部物件從原有的專案中全部移出,重新建一個新的PJT,然後再將全物件移到新的地方試試 |
|
回頂端 |
|
|
|